An opportunity for an Employment Lawyer has become available to work at Durham County Council as part of the Legal and Democratic Services Team.
Durham County Council is the 8th Largest Local Authority in the country supported by an experienced and talented legal service. Based in Durham City with excellent transport links our County is a fascinating place to work with rich history and heritage, coastline as well as areas of outstanding natural beauty and a world heritage site on the doorstep.
We actively promote a positive work / life balance and support wellbeing. We offer flexible hybrid working, a friendly and supportive working environment and a wealth of interesting work.
WHAT IS INVOLVED?
This motivated highly professional team is looking for an individual committed to excellence to undertake employment work. You will support and assist the Senior Lawyer (Corporate and Commercial Governance) as well as being responsible for their own caseload, providing a professional legal service with support from dedicated Legal Assistants.
As an Employment Lawyer, you will be involved in undertaking;
- Employment matters both contentious and non-contentious including advising on disciplinary and grievance matters, policy reviews, change management processes and TUPE transfers.
- Pensions matters including attendance at Committee meetings; and
- undertaking high quality advocacy, representing the Council before courts and tribunals.
Previous experience of Employment Law is essential to the role.

WHAT WILL I NEED?
You should be a Qualified Solicitor, Barrister or Chartered Legal Executive with current practising certificate (will consider those about to qualify having completed all academic stages).

OUR OFFER TO YOU
We offer a competitive rewards package that includes attractive salaries, a generous annual leave entitlement of 27 days (rising to 32 after five years continuous local government service), membership of the excellent contributory career average Local Government Pension Scheme, and a range of flexible working arrangements including hybrid working (home and office) where applicable.
